Western Massachusetts Chiefs Of Police Association Inc

Organization Overview

Western Massachusetts Chiefs Of Police Association Inc is located in Feeding Hills, MA. The organization was established in 1987. According to its NTEE Classification (I03) the organization is classified as: Professional Societies & Associations, under the broad grouping of Crime & Legal-Related and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Western Massachusetts Chiefs Of Police Association Inc is a 501(c)(6) and as such, is described as a "Business League, Chambers of Commerce, or Real Estate Board" by the IRS.

For the year ending 12/2022, Western Massachusetts Chiefs Of Police Association Inc generated $113.5k in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 8 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(7.8%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$90.1k during the year ending 12/2022. As we would expect to see with falling revenues, expenses have declined by (10.8%) per year over the past 8 years.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

THE WESTERN MASSACHUSETTS CHIEFS OF POLICE ASSOCIATION, INC. IS ORGANIZED FOR THE SPECIFIC PURPOSE OF INFORMATIONAL EXCHANGE AS IT PERTAINS TO LAW ENFORCEMENT ISSUES. IT IS COMPOSED OF CHIEFS OF POLICE OF THE FOUR (4) WESTERN COUNTIES OF THE COMMONWEALTH OF MASSACHUSETTS; BERKSHIRE, FRANKLIN, HAMPSHIRE, AND HAMPDEN COUNTIES, AND PERSONS INTERESTED IN LAW ENFORCEMENT AND WILL BE CONSISTENT IN PURPOSE WITH THE MASSACHUSETTS CHIEFS OF POLICE ASSOCIATION AND IN TURN, THE NEW ENGLAND CHIEFS OF POLICE ASSOCIATION, AND THE INTERNATIONAL ASSOCIATION OF CHIEFS OF POLICE. IT SHALL BE THE DUTY OF THIS ASSOCIATION TO AID ITS MEMBERS IN THE DISCHARGE OF THEIR DUTIES, GIVE COUNSEL ON QUESTIONS AND MATTERS RELATING TO THE WELFARE OF THE ASSOCIATION, OR INDIVIDUAL MEMBERS THEREOF.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

PROGRAMS CONSIST OF MONTHLY MEETINGS WHERE COMMITTEE CHAIRMAN PROVIDE AN INFORMATIONAL EXCHANGE WITH MEMBERS, DIRECTORS, AND OTHER LAW ENFORCEMENT AGENCIES RELATED TO LAW ENFORCEMENT ISSUES, CURRENT AND CHANGING LEGISLATION AND PROFESSIONAL DEVELOPMENT.
